As with any meal worthy of repeated eating, this curry proves itself time and time again when left to simmer gently over a period of hours, rather than minutes (which is an excellent rule of thumb when cooking any meats). And while confidently spicy, it avoids falling victim to an overabundance of chillies, relying instead upon the effective blend of spices, minimal preparation and a long cooking time to intensify the final dish. Try it out for yourself, and I guarantee that you’ll love it almost as much as I do.
Ingredients (Serves 4)
400g of Lamb Shoulder Steaks (Diced)
4 Tbsps of Olive or Sunflower Oil
Medium Onion (Finely Chopped)
4 Garlic Cloves (Peeled and Grated)
1” of Fresh Ginger (Peeled and Grated)
400g Tin of Chopped Tomatoes
Tbsp Tomato Purée
Tbsp Garam Masala
Tsp Ground Cumin
0.5 Tsp Ground Turmeric
100ml Natural Yoghurt
Fresh Chilli Pepper (Seeded and Finely Chopped)
25g Pack of Fresh Coriander (Finely Chopped)
How to Cook
1. Heat the oil in a non-stick chef pan (or similar) and then gently fry the chopped onion and garlic, stir-frying until the onions are lightly browned.
2. Add the ginger, ground cumin, turmeric and chopped chili, stir-frying for 1-2 minutes before adding the diced lamb, yoghurt, tomato purée and salt.
3. Mix well, add the chopped tomatoes and water, and gently simmer covered for 1 hour before adding the freshly chopped coriander.
4. Mix everything well, and simmer uncovered for a further 15-20 minutes, while the sauce thickens and reduces, and the lamb becomes soft and tender to the touch.
If you find that you’re not a huge fan of lamb, then this recipe works equally well with diced pork or beef, and is best served with natural yoghurt and steaming plain basmati rice, or even stuffed inside warm buttered chapatis with a topping of Indian salad.